全景百科 生活 西门子STL解读:括号内STL代码解读

西门子STL解读:括号内STL代码解读

在网上看到一段西门的STL代码,二进制逻辑上还有一些运算,很多朋友不知道该怎么看,我们从代码解读的角度进行分析,然后用SCL和LAD的方式实现这单代码的功能。1

1.STL代码

数据接口

STL代码

代码很少。代码中比较难理解的是下面这一段:

西门子STL解读:括号内STL代码解读

A(A #inout1JNB m001L #in2L 20+IT #temp1AN OVSAVECLRm001: A BR) 只需将括号内的程序视为中间结果,并将其带入原始程序即可。从括号内的程序解析:

如果INOUT1 为TRUE,则执行逻辑加法运算。 IN2与20相加的结果放入temp1中,进行加法运算的溢出判断,并将结果保存在BR位中;如果INOUT1为假,程序将存储BR位Reset并跳转到M001的位置;

流程图

本节括号内的程序是判断BR位的结果。 BR 位的结果受程序中操作的影响。

西门子STL解读:括号内STL代码解读

2. 转换SCL代码

使用LAD就这么简单,稍微有点PLC知识的人都可以理解,所以我就不分析了。

梯形图代码

总结:

用户评论


北染陌人

看不懂STL里的括号用法,这篇文章能解答我疑惑吗?

    有14位网友表示赞同!


拉扯

终于找到解释西门子STL括号用的文章了!

    有12位网友表示赞同!


走过海棠暮

西门子工业自动化常用的STL程序太难弄懂,这个标题看起来很有用。

    有7位网友表示赞同!


余笙南吟

上课的时候老师总是说要掌握STL的括号用法,可是没怎么讲过具体怎么用。

    有9位网友表示赞同!


残花为谁悲丶

学习西门子PLC写程序的时候遇到很多问题, STL的括号定义是其中一个难题,希望能详细讲解!

    有9位网友表示赞同!


绝版女子

要学习STL就要理解括号的使用, 这样才能够灵活运用。

    有18位网友表示赞同!


她的风骚姿势我学不来

这个标题简直太贴切了,我一直在苦恼这个问题!

    有7位网友表示赞同!


此生一诺

对编程不太了解,但是希望通过这篇文章能学习到一些西门子STL编程的基础知识。

    有14位网友表示赞同!


屌国女农

STL的括号用法确实很关键, 希望这篇文章能够深入浅出解释。

    有5位网友表示赞同!


强辩

我以前就觉得西门子PLC编程难学,看这文章后好像可以克服困难了。

    有19位网友表示赞同!


ok绷遮不住我颓废的伤あ

学习西门子PLC真的不容易

    有14位网友表示赞同!


厌归人

这篇文章应该非常有用!我会仔细阅读并学习其中的知识点。

    有12位网友表示赞同!


你与清晨阳光

西门子的STL编程确实不是那么容易理解, 希望这篇文章能帮助我!

    有15位网友表示赞同!


冷月花魂

我正在学习西门子PLC编程,希望能通过这篇文章更深入地了解STL

    有9位网友表示赞同!


柠栀

终于找到解释STL括号用法讲解的文章了!

    有13位网友表示赞同!


一个人的荒凉

西门子STL的括号定义非常重要!

    有14位网友表示赞同!


不浪漫罪名

这篇文章能帮我看清西门子STL代码中的括号吗?

    有9位网友表示赞同!

本文来自网络,不代表全景百科立场,转载请注明出处:https://www.ytphoto.com/98224.html

作者: xiaobian

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注